Latest Patents

His patent titled "Method for detecting cancer and reagents for use therein" outlines a groundbreaking approach for the early detection of cancer. This method utilizes a first detection reagent containing a first adsorbent, which is designed to be physically adsorbed by biomedical samples. The first adsorbent consists of a long-chain ester wax containing between 16-46 carbon atoms or a long-chain alkane wax comprising 21-30 carbon atoms. The concentration of this adsorbent is maintained at levels between 5% to 10% w/w. This innovative method allows for rapid and non-invasive detection of various cancers based on the differential physisorption capabilities of the adsorbent.

Career Highlights

Ching-Iue Chen is affiliated with the National Synchrotron Radiation Research Center, where he engages in research that integrates physics and chemistry to advance diagnostic technologies.
